MS Exchange is the most used groupware solution out there in the market. 
That's quite sad but happily Microsoft created the EWS API with Exchange 
version 2007+ so there is the possibility for us to use these. And with kdsoap 
from KDAB this shouldn't be that difficult to achieve I think.
